[問題] 為什麼要送時脈給IC呢

看板Electronics作者 (jones)時間7年前 (2016/11/25 21:23), 7年前編輯推噓4(403)
留言7則, 6人參與, 最新討論串1/1
小弟是嵌入式的新手, 其實是想問三個關於時脈送進IC的問題。 因為在點亮硬體的過程,需要透過程式去去調整送進IC的時脈頻率。 以下有兩個問題,請大大幫忙解答 1. 基本上有送電壓進IC,他應該就可以動了,為什麼還需要送時脈呢,因為有一根pin腳 專門在餵時脈給IC。 是因為IC內部要靠這時脈校準所送出的訊號嗎? 2. 時脈太高或太低,為什麼會導致IC無法正常工作? -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 42.73.149.187 ※ 文章網址: https://www.ptt.cc/bbs/Electronics/M.1480080186.A.9CC.html

11/25 21:36, , 1F
請去看數位電子學 邏輯設計的組合邏輯和循序邏輯
11/25 21:36, 1F

11/25 21:37, , 2F
照clock順序一一幹事就是循序邏輯
11/25 21:37, 2F

11/25 23:18, , 3F
sequential logic circuit
11/25 23:18, 3F
謝謝,有去wiki看一下。那速度應該可以有多快就做多快。為什麼時脈會有上限,是會有 過熱的問題嗎? ※ 編輯: ghost1006 (42.73.149.187), 11/26/2016 00:15:29

11/26 00:54, , 4F
你問的限制,是ic的還是震盪器的?
11/26 00:54, 4F
IC,因為有一次設錯,把16Mhz設成32Mhz結果不會動。

11/26 01:49, , 5F
就邏輯電路的充放電速度限制了運作速度阿
11/26 01:49, 5F
※ 編輯: ghost1006 (42.73.149.187), 11/26/2016 07:49:45

11/26 12:50, , 6F
速度問題關鍵字 setup time, hold time
11/26 12:50, 6F
謝謝,透過您的關鍵字,我找到答案囉。 ※ 編輯: ghost1006 (42.73.149.187), 11/26/2016 19:46:06

11/26 21:05, , 7F
很多都內建 clock source 了
11/26 21:05, 7F
文章代碼(AID): #1OE3iwdC (Electronics)